The transcript features a speech by Theresa May, introduced by Brandon, highlighting the efforts of the Conservative Party in Grimsby and North East Lincolnshire. It discusses the challenges faced due to the Brexit deal not being passed through Parliament, affecting local elections. Despite difficulties, the Conservative Party achieved control in North East Lincolnshire. May acknowledges the hard work of local councillors and emphasizes the importance of delivering Brexit. The speech concludes with encouragement for youth involvement in politics.
